Top 10 highlights of wireless communications in 2013

In the 2013 key strategic plans issued by the three major operators and the predictions of major investment institutions and consulting agencies, in the new year's ICT development trend, wireless communication with LTE as the prominent content still occupies a prominent position. Different from previous years, China's LTE is expected to usher in commercial, cloud computing and big data to promote the upgrade of wireless city architecture, WLAN presents the characteristics of Gigabit wireless connection, etc., becoming a new bright spot in the wireless field in the new year.

1 LTE: Commercial approaching investment becomes rational

According to the latest statistics given by the Global Mobile Suppliers Association (GSA) on January 15, 145 operators in 66 countries have launched commercial LTE services, and in 2012, 104 new operators promised to invest in LTE network deployment To increase the total number of operators committed to deployment to 330 in 104 countries. GSA also predicts that by the end of 2013, LTE commercial networks will reach 209.

The industry predicts that the domestic TD-LTE industry chain will launch a 28-nanometer TD-LTE multi-mode chip, whose performance basically reaches the level of large-scale application, and supports the development and application of TD-LTE smart phones.

2 R11 technical verification is coming

As the evolution technology of LTE, R10, which has been intensively tested in the TD-LTE scale test, mainly focuses on LTE carrier aggregation, uplink and downlink multi-antenna technology enhancement, and interference cancellation between cells. From 2012 to 2013, the industry will discuss and verify R11 enhanced carrier aggregation, CoMP, enhanced inter-cell interference cancellation and other technologies.

In the second half of 2012, 3GPP also initiated the standardization of R12. According to 3GPP standardization experts, R12 will be a milestone version of LTE-Advanced to address the severe capacity and coverage issues in the mobile Internet era.

3 Dual carrier HSPA + becomes mainstream

Although LTE has become the fastest-growing technology in the market, HSPA is still the mainstream technology choice for global operators in terms of commercial volume, and will continue to play the role of "3G leader" in 2013 in the world and domestically.

According to GSA statistics, there are already 254 officially commercial HSPA + networks distributed in 118 countries worldwide, and the number of 42Mbit / s HSPA + commercial networks using dual-carrier technology doubled in 2012 to more than 100. The dual-carrier HSPA + network will become mainstream in 2013. In China, as of the end of 2012, the number of cities where China Unicom opened HSPA + network services increased to 336.

4 802.11ac emergence technology effect

Stepping into the 802.11n era, the pilot of non-aware authentication became the two major characteristics of the domestic operator Wi-Fi market in 2012. On this basis, chip, routing equipment and other manufacturers began to launch a series of 802.11ac products, focusing on the concept of Gigabit wireless network. From a technical point of view, 802.11ac significantly increases the available bandwidth of Wi-Fi links and enhances the functions of various new applications, such as reliable high-definition video streaming, high-speed wireless backup, and data synchronization of mobile devices.

7 Wireless LAN expansion frequency band

In November 2012, senior officials of the Radio Management Bureau of the Ministry of Industry and Information Technology publicly stated that in order to support the application and development of WLAN, the Radio Management Bureau has planned to plan the three bands of 5150MHz-5250MHz, 5250MHz-5350MHz, and 5470MHz-5725MHz in the 5G frequency band for a total of 455MHz. It is the wireless LAN spectrum. Allegedly, the Radio Administration Bureau of the Ministry of Industry and Information Technology “will release the WLAN frequency plan in due course”.

9 Wi-Fi Perceptionless Scale Promotion

Despite the increasing number of hotspots, the trend of users actively choosing and paying for Wi-Fi in Wi-Fi public hotspot areas is far less rapid than network construction. One of the problems is that the authentication and use process is relatively complicated. In 2012, the Wi-Fi non-aware authentication technology developed jointly by China Mobile-based operators and the industry chain is gradually maturing. The industry predicts that in 2013, Wi-Fi non-aware authentication is expected to be widely promoted and applied.

10 NFC technology expands the scope of application

Distance wireless communication (NFC) has become famous for its use in mobile payment methods in the past two years. In fact, NFC's increasingly significant growth trend will prompt its application in more consumer electronics products, including game controllers, televisions, remote controls, computer keyboards, mice, headphones, printers, and so on. NFC mobile phones with embedded virtual credential cards have a wide range of uses since 2013. NFC-based technical solutions have emerged in areas such as car launch, access control, hotel management, and smart home.
